iShares Core MSCI Emerging Markets ETF

1,444 hedge funds and large institutions have $52.3B invested in iShares Core MSCI Emerging Markets ETF in 2022 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 102 funds opening new positions, 634 increasing their positions, 572 reducing their positions, and 116 closing their positions.
